By feeding more random bits into mmap allocation, the
effectiveness of KASLR will be improved, making attacks
trying to bypass address randomisation more difficult.
Changed sysctl values are:
vm.mmap_rnd_bits = 32 (default: 28)
vm.mmap_rnd_compat_bits = 16 (default: 8)
